how would you find the first common multiple of 12 and 15

Answer:

The first common multiple is 60

Step-by-step explanation:

The first common multiple can be found by making a list of multiples of each number and finding the first one that is the same:

12x1=12

12x2=24

12x3=36

12x4=48

12x5=60

15x1=15

15x2=30

15x3=45

15x4=60

Notice that 12x5=60 and 15x4=60

This is the first multiple they have in common, therefore 60 is the first common multiple.
